Understanding the Basics of Crossy Road

Before diving into analyzing 100 rounds of data from Crossy Road, it’s essential to understand what the game is all about. Crossy Road is a popular mobile game developed by Hipster Whale that has gained massive popularity worldwide. The game is based on the concept of guiding a character through various environments while avoiding obstacles and collecting power-ups.

Setting Up the Experiment

To analyze 100 rounds of data from Crossy Road, you’ll need to set up an experiment that allows you to collect and record gameplay data. Here’s a step-by-step guide on how to do it:

  1. Choose a platform : You can use either Android or iOS devices for this experiment, but make sure they are all running the same version of the game.
  2. Select a character : Pick one character from the game that you want to focus your analysis on. This will help you isolate the variables and observe any patterns specific to that character.
  3. Set up recording software : You can use screen recording software like OBS Studio or Adobe Captivate to record gameplay data, including audio and video. Alternatively, you can also use a third-party app specifically designed for gaming analytics.
  4. Configure game settings : Set the game to run in "Normal" mode with no cheats enabled. This will give you an accurate representation of how players typically play the game.

Collecting Data

Once your setup is complete, it’s time to start collecting data. Here are some tips on how to go about it:

  1. Play 100 rounds : Play the game for 100 consecutive rounds using the same character and settings. Make sure to take regular breaks to avoid fatigue.
  2. Record gameplay : Use the screen recording software or app to capture video and audio of your gameplay sessions. This will provide a visual representation of your progress and any patterns you observe.
  3. Take notes : While playing, take notes on your performance, including any notable achievements, successes, or failures.

Analyzing Data

Now that you have collected 100 rounds of data from Crossy Road, it’s time to analyze it. Here are some steps to follow:

  1. Identify patterns : Look for patterns in your gameplay data, such as the number of coins earned per round, the frequency of deaths, or the average time taken to complete a level.
  2. Calculate statistics : Calculate various statistics, including the mean, median, and standard deviation of your gameplay metrics.
  3. Visualize data : Use visualization tools like graphs, charts, or heat maps to represent your data in an easily digestible format.
